Manufacturer and industry best practice recommends calibration annually, or more frequently if used in critical or high-accuracy applications. Site quality standards or regulatory requirements may specify different intervals.

Product Information
- Manufacturer: Brooks Instrument
- Model Number: 5850IA1BF3T2BEA
- Model Details: High-performance, thermal mass flow controller for gases, widely used in laboratory, industrial, and OEM applications.
- Category: Mass Flow Controller
